Job description
The Senior Executive - Recruitment at Dubai Holding Group Services is responsible for managing and executing end-to-end recruitment operations within the shared services Human Capital function. The role encompasses leading recruitment for senior and multiple stakeholders, coordinating candidate evaluations, facilitating interviews, managing offers and negotiations, ensuring high-quality hires with attention to technical skills, cultural fit, and potential, and promoting diversity and inclusion. The position also involves collaborating with sourcing teams to maintain candidate pipelines, implementing process optimizations, managing internal and external recruitment relationships including agencies, universities, and professional networks, tracking recruitment metrics, maintaining compliance with employment and data privacy regulations, and delivering a seamless candidate experience aligned with organizational talent acquisition goals. Proficiency in HRIS, applicant tracking systems, recruitment technologies, and sourcing channels is required, along with experience in Middle East recruitment and knowledge of real estate/community management preferred.

Key responsibilities
- Lead recruitment for senior and multiple stakeholders, acting as the main point of contact and providing regular updates
- Manage the full recruitment lifecycle including job postings, candidate screening, interview coordination, conducting Behavioral Based Interviews (BBI), and facilitating offers and negotiations
- Ensure high-quality hires by assessing technical skills, cultural fit, and potential, while promoting diversity and inclusion
- Partner with sourcing teams to maintain strong candidate pipelines, provide feedback on sourcing strategies, and ensure timely recruitment decisions
- Identify and implement improvements in recruitment operations to enhance efficiency and candidate experience
- Manage relationships with internal teams and external partners to support recruitment objectives
- Track recruitment metrics, maintain data privacy compliance, and provide insights to improve recruitment effectiveness and alignment with organizational policies
Experience & skills
- Bachelor’s deg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, or a related field
- 2–4 years of experience in talent acquisition, ideally with at least 2 years in a shared services environment
- Experience in the Middle East, with real estate asset/community management recruitment experience preferred
- Proficiency in HRIS, applicant tracking systems, recruitment technologies, and sourcing channels
- Strong understanding of employment laws, data privacy regulations, and relevant industry trends
- Ability to manage stakeholders, negotiate, assess and evaluate candidates, and report recruitment analytics
- Customer-focused, effective communicator, adaptable, critical thinker, and strong time management skills
- Ability to attract and assess diverse talent while ensuring alignment with organizational values
